Company History At C&B Piping, LLC, our goal is not to be the largest supplier, but to be the best supplier of ductile Iron Pipe and Steel fabrication products in the industry. Since 1986, we're proud to be a full-service manufacturing supplier of ductile iron piping systems with a primary focus on water and wastewater treatment plant. We are in the industry of supplying piping systems that keep clean water flowing across the country. We handle the full range (3" - 64" +) of ductile iron pipe. We are licensed applicators of Protecto 401 Ceramic Epoxy and Ceramapure PL90 linings and we do it all while treating our customers just as we would want to be treated. From our headquarters in Leeds, Alabama, and facilities in Arizona and Virginia, we're known nationwide as the largest provider of porcelain glass‑lined ductile iron piping systems. We build more than pipe; our craftsmanship, innovation, and unwavering customer care begins with our people. Now an independent subsidiary of AMERICAN Cast Iron Pipe Company, we're growing stronger than ever. What You’ll Be Doing as the Billing Specialist
Review billing discrepancies and resolve all invoices accurately and timely.
Review billing data for compliance with contracts or pricing agreements.
Maintain meticulous and detailed records and documentation.
Collaborate with Project Managers and Sales professionals daily.
Understand product codes and dimensions.
Understand work orders and variances.
ERP experience is a plus.
Process adjustments, credits, and rebills as needed.
Match vendor invoices to PO receipts, resolve discrepancies, and issue payments with precision.
Reconciling vendor accounts along with credit card statements.
Support Accounts Receivable by creating invoices, posting payments, and assisting with collections as needed.
Prepare journal entries, general ledger reconciliations, and month‑end accruals.
Partner with teammates across departments to improve processes and ensure financial accuracy.
Maintain confidentiality of all financial, customer, and vendor information.
